gydtep 发表于 2021-1-4 10:58:55
按照商业和开源数据库的角度来看,两者依旧是平分天下。在商业数据库领域,具有代表性的数据库有Oracle、SQL Server等;而在开源数据库领域,具有代表性的数据由MySQL和PG等。gydtep 发表于 2021-1-4 14:54:34
如何打开未来数据库的市场,让自己的产品服务到更多的用户,充分利用好云为我们提供的基础设施是最重要的。现在全球的几个比较著名的新兴数据库厂商,比如Atlas(MongoDB)、SkySQL(MariaDB)、Redis企业云等都提供了多云部署架构,而今年比较火的Snowflake提供了完全的云原生部署,其不像是MySQL那样可以下载,而只能运行在云上面,gydtep 发表于 2021-1-4 16:52:58
2016年时,阿里巴巴数据库的自动驾驶平台叫做CloudDBA,这个产品所需要解决的核心问题就是整个阿里巴巴集团的数据库自动化运维的问题。当时阿里巴巴集团的数据库实例非常多,大约有几十万个,面对如此之多的数据库实例,仅依靠DBA人工运维很难保障。gydtep 发表于 2021-1-5 08:00:54
企业管理员和存储供应商处理各种各样的存储类型。而且,它们还满足不同输入/输出服务的指标。大型文件共享应用可能需要适当的吞吐量,但也必须允许延迟损失,因为大型而复杂的应用可能会对延迟产生不利影响。gydtep 发表于 2021-1-5 10:34:03
对于应用交付的整个流程而言,通常会涉及三个环节,即开发、测试和运维,而在传统的组织架构中,他们对应的也往往是三个不同的团队。这三个环节各自有自己的侧重点,但是在实际上,想要让整个应用交付过程变得顺滑高效,并且让应用在上线后保持高可用的状态,往往需要三个团队将相互之间存在的墙打破掉。gydtep 发表于 2021-1-5 14:20:40
基于非常高效的云API来构建应用的好处在于构建的成本很低,并且能够实现按天、按小时进行交付,并且大大降低未来运维的负担。gydtep 发表于 2021-1-5 16:42:14
代码文本不是简单的二维平面结构,看懂一段代码需要反复地通过定义与引用的跳转,才能将代码深层次的逻辑和片段影响范围理解透彻。gydtep 发表于 2021-1-5 18:33:46
针对不同语言,我们只需要实现一次从源代码到LSIF格式的转换,就能将其应用在多种场景。多种代码语言代码语言都会被解析成统一的LSIF格式文件。gydtep 发表于 2021-1-6 10:22:30
在一个简单的微服务架构中,如果某应用处于整个链路的入口位置,它的前端一般会挂上负载均衡组件(上图中的应用 A),以承接来自于最终用户的业务请求。gydtep 发表于 2021-1-6 14:24:49
我们可以做一个简单的统计:把所有服务器的 CPU 利用率每 5 分钟导出一次,按照天的维度求平均值,就能从整体上了解系统的资源利用率数据。如果把开发测试环境的服务器资源也纳入统计的范围,资源利用率很有可能会更低。